When rolling and expanding tubes, how far should they extend?

  1. 1/8", 1/4", 1/2"

  2. 1/4", 1/2", 3/4"

  3. 1/2", 3/4", 1"

  4. 3/4", 1", 1 1/4"

The correct answer is: 1/4", 1/2", 3/4"

The correct choice indicates that when rolling and expanding tubes, the ideal extension should be in the range of 1/4 inch to 3/4 inch. This range is a standard practice in the industry, ensuring a proper fit and effective sealing between the tubes and headers. Effective rolling and expanding are essential for maintaining the integrity of boiler systems, as they help in preventing leaks and ensuring efficient operation.
